How much food should a dog eat in a day?

For adult dogs, the general recommendation is to feed them twice a day. A good rule of thumb is to feed them about 1/2 to 1 cup of food for every 20 pounds of body weight. However, this can vary depending on the dog’s size, activity level, and age. Puppies may need to be fed three or more times a day, and seniors may need to be fed smaller amounts more frequently. For more specific information, you should consult your veterinarian.

How much food should I feed my dog chart?

A dog feeding chart should provide guidance on how much food to feed your dog based on their weight. Generally, toy breeds (3-6 pounds) should be fed 1/3 to 1/2 cup of food per day, small breeds (10-20 pounds) should be fed 3/4 cup to 1 1/2 cups of food per day, medium breeds (20-50 pounds) should be fed 1 1/2 to 2 1/2 cups of food per day, and large breeds (50+ pounds) should be fed 2 1/2 to 4 cups of food per day. However, it is important to note that these are only general guidelines, and the actual amount of food your dog needs may vary depending on their individual metabolism and activity level.

How do I calculate how much food my dog needs?

To calculate how much food your dog needs, you should consider your dog’s age, weight, activity level, and any health conditions he or she may have. Generally, puppies and younger adult dogs need more food than older adult dogs, and active dogs need more food than less active dogs. How do I know if I’m feeding my dog enough?

You can tell if you are feeding your dog enough by looking for certain signs. If your dog is maintaining a healthy weight and has a glossy coat, this is a good indication that you are feeding your dog enough. Additionally, you can observe your dog’s behavior. If your dog is alert, active, and has a good appetite, this is another sign that you are feeding your dog the correct amount of food. Finally, you can check your dog’s ribs. If you can feel them but not see them, this is usually a sign that your dog is getting enough food.

How much should a 27 kg dog eat?

A 27 kg (or 59.4 lb) dog should eat between 1000-1244 kilocalories per day. This amount should be split into two or three meals throughout the day. It is important to feed your dog a high-quality, nutrient-dense food that is appropriate for their age, size, and activity level.
